The process of producing a video clip from concept to completion contains three phases: Pre-Production, Manufacturing and Post-Production.
The Ultimate Guide To Video Production
This conference is usually held in between our Multimedia Solutions group and the key factor person for the task. Make certain to establish the timeline, determine the personalities, and complete any type of location information. This meeting can be done over the phone or in person. Depending upon the intricacy of the shoot, it can be practical to do a website visit to your place, particularly if neither the producer or videographer has actually seen it.
All these details will certainly aid guarantee that the manufacturing stage goes efficiently. The production phase is where you catch all the meetings and video for your video.

During the post-production phase, your video production team will start the procedure to arrange, plan, and modify the real video clip. Your producer will meticulously review all the footage and record every one of the meetings conducted. Then, they will put together the tale and the video editor does their magic to bring all the pieces together.

Before we dive in, allow's define the term "video manufacturer" and learn regarding the duties linked with this really vital task. It is his or her obligation to make certain that the final video fulfills the client's innovative vision, is provided on time and on or under budget.
The producer assembles the team and makes sure all crew participants dealing with the manufacturing are unified to deliver the innovative vision for the video clip. Attribute Movie website link or Tier 1 Commercials may have extra Manufacturer functions such as "Line Producers", that just handle the see spending plan "Post-Production or VFX Producers", that just operate in post-production phases, or "Partner Producers" to aid in details locations required.
or for smaller budgets, they will certainly build and directly manage smaller sized groups including camera drivers, scriptwriters, editors, graphic designers, and extra. The Manufacturer can be seen as the "CEO" for the video clip manufacturing, so this function holds a lot of responsibility and is straight connected to the success of the video clip.
